Digicel rewards top ten vendors
In a continued effort to make sure that all members of the Digicel family are contented, the telecommunications provider presented 10 of its leading top-up sellers with free credit on Wednesday.{{more}}
Handing over the credit to the resellers, Channel Manager Gershom Dick said that the presentation is one way that Digicel rewards their top sellers.
âOver the years and recent months they have been very active in selling for Digicel, so we just want to give something back to them to say thank you for pushing Digicel and making us the bigger better networkâ, said Dick. Each person got credit ranging from EC$200 to EC$500. Operations Manager at ABS (Digicelâs Main Distributor) Ezzie Roberts witnessed the presentation.
